Remove unused Fomantic sidebar module #16853

Merged
silverwind merged 7 commits from rmsidebar into main 2021-08-29 19:57:07 +00:00
silverwind commented 2021-08-28 01:12:09 +00:00 (Migrated from github.com)

The Sidebar module seems currently unused (at least I can't find any reference to it in templates or js), so remove it from the Fomantic build, reducing frontend asset size by around 40kB before minification.

Also included are related changes which remove useless minified files output and mark those build files as being generated, so that they auto-collapse in diffs.

The [Sidebar](https://fomantic-ui.com/modules/sidebar.html) module seems currently unused (at least I can't find any reference to it in templates or js), so remove it from the Fomantic build, reducing frontend asset size by around 40kB before minification. Also included are related changes which remove useless minified files output and mark those build files as being generated, so that they auto-collapse in diffs.
6543 (Migrated from github.com) approved these changes 2021-08-28 14:07:31 +00:00
zeripath approved these changes 2021-08-29 14:41:37 +00:00
This repo is archived. You cannot comment on pull requests.
No reviewers
No Milestone
No project
No Assignees
2 Participants
Due Date
The due date is invalid or out of range. Please use the format 'yyyy-mm-dd'.

No due date set.

Dependencies

No dependencies set.

Reference: lunny/gitea#16853
No description provided.